Jacqueline F. Botkin
Jacqueline F. "Jackie" Botkin, 77, of Springfield died at 3:30 p.m. February 23, 2009 in Oakwood Village. She was born in Springfield on November 9, 1931 the daughter of Daniel K. and Mary C. (Garrett) Keleher.
She retired in 1987 from W.P.A.F.B. after thirty-four years of service.
Survivors include three children and spouses, Lori and Jay Carpenter, Randy and Debbie Botkin all of Springfield, Greg A. Botkin, Davie, FL; six grandchildren, Hilarie, Hayley, Colm, Caleb, Chris and Ryan; great granddaughter, Moira; sister, Norma Jackson, Springfield and several n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her husband George in 1995, a son Rick Botkin and a daughter Vicki Botkin.
A memorial service will be held at 7:00 p.m. Friday in the Conroy Funeral Home with Pastor Roger A. Herrig officiating. Family will receive friends one hour prior to the service.
The family would like to offer a special thanks to Dr. To and all the staff at Oakwood Village for the wonderful care and support they gave to Jackie. Inurnment will be in Glen Haven Memorial Gardens. Memorial donations may be made to the American Heart Association.
